Get PriceBeginning in 2024 Cortec invested millions of dollars in the exploration and development of a niobium and rare earths mine in the Mrima Hill forest reserve area of Kenya Cortec was initially granted a prospecting licence for its project over an area that originally did not include Mrima Hill
